
Linda G. Klempner, PhD, PMH-C
Linda was Membership Chair and Secretary of the PSI Board from 2007-2012 and was Advisory Council Chair from 2014-2024. She is currently involved with PSI’s Development Committee. Co-founder of PSI’s New Jersey Chapter, she served in numerous Board positions. For many years, she was a facilitator for PSI’s Chat with an Expert. Additionally, she was a founding member of The North American Menopause Society and served on the PPD Taskforce of the Partnership for Maternal and Child Health of Northern New Jersey. Linda has written, spoken, and appeared on television about reproductive health issues. She received the Star of Resolve Award for service to those suffering from infertility in 1999. She began Women’s Health Counseling & Psychotherapy in Teaneck, N.J., and has been a clinical psychologist in private practice with a specialty in women’s reproductive health for over thirty-five years.
